A resolution commemorating the 90th birthday of His Holiness the 14th Dalai Lama on July 6, 2025, as "A Day of Compassion" and expressing support for the human rights and distinct religious, cultural, linguistic, and historical identity of the Tibetan people.
119-sres283 — A resolution commemorating the 90th birthday of His Holiness the 14th Dalai Lama on July 6, 2025, as "A Day of Compassion" and expressing support for the human rights and distinct religious, cultural, linguistic, and historical identity of the Tibetan people.. Sponsored by Sen. Merkley, Jeff [D-OR]. Introduced 2025-06-17. Senate bill. 119th Congress. Latest action: Resolution agreed to in Senate with an amendment and with a preamble by Unanimous Consent.
